On Tue, Oct 11, 2022 at 12:41:50PM +0200, Eugenio Pérez wrote:
> SVQ may run or not in a device depending on runtime conditions (for
> example, if the device can move CVQ to its own group or not).
> 
> Allocate the resources unconditionally, and decide later if to use them
> or not.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Eugenio Pérez <eperezma@redhat.com>

I applied this for now but I really dislike it that we are wasting
resources like this.

Can I just drop this patch from the series? It looks like things
will just work anyway ...

I know, when one works on a feature it seems like everyone should
enable it - but the reality is qemu already works quite well for
most users and it is our resposibility to first do no harm.
